In parallelogram ABCD, the diagonal AC is the bisector of angle A. Find the perimeter of ABCD if side Ab is side 8.

The angle of the BCA is equal to the angle DАС (internal criss-crossing angles with parallel АD and ВС and secant АС). The angle CAD is equal to the angle CAB (since A is the bisector).

This means that triangle ABC is isosceles (an isosceles triangle has equal angles at the base). Hence, ВA = BC = 8.

In a parallelogram, opposite sides are equal, which means that all sides of the parallelogram are 8, PABCD = 8 * 4 = 32.

Answer: the perimeter of the parallelogram ABCD is 32.
